Here's how you can get to see Max: once you walk over the bridge
(right before you get to the passages that lead to the marketplace), a
lady will come running out of one of the passages on the other side and
cross over the bridge. She then runs to the locked door on the other
side. As far as I know, there is no way to get through that door except
to wait for her to open it and slip in behind her. Max is in the living
room of the lady's house.
If you open the door for him, he'll run outside. Sometimes I have
to push him over to the door, though (the furniture in the house seems
to get in his way). If you don't shoot him, he'll sometimes go apeshit
and start shooting at everything that moves (pedestrians included). If
you do shoot him, you'd better run or load a saved game 'cause he's
gonna kick your ass!

to get to the little bunny feller:

at one point your walking thru a tunnel in the city, as you leave the
tunnel, you can turn right to get to a 'bar' with a bunch of bad guys
fighting. instead of turning right to the bar, walk straight ahead and
walk toward the room with the locked door near the river. as your
walking toward that room, you will hear the sound of its door opening
(it opens before you can see it) ..... run like hell to get around the
corner and in the door, you might have to shove the Lea look-alike out
of the way. You only get one chance at this, miss it and the door
stays locked. You will have to re-start the level to get into the
room. I recommend saving the game before exiting the tunnel.
I dont like letting this guy loose, though..... he shoots all the
civilians!! and if you try to shoot him, he wont die, and will blast
you out of your jedi boots.

He did that to me, too. Here's what you have to do. Start over again
(yeah, that sucks) and this time, when you go in the room you'll see Max
on the chair. Don't walk into him, just walk over in front of him and
hit the "use" button on him. He'll hop up and walk over to the door.
Open the door and he'll run outside. He seems to have trouble getting up
the steps on the bridge though...

And that woman that returns? When you first walk out of the tunnel and
the door opens, that is her leaving the building. You can see her
walking over the bridge towards the stores and stuff. If you follow her,
she goes to one of the stores, stands by a counter, then walks back to
the building and goes in again. Yes, I was pretty bored tonight... :)
